NDTV tops digital charts with strong January YouTube viewership

New Delhi, 02-February -2026, By IBW Team

NDTV

NDTV has begun 2026 on a strong digital note, cementing its leadership position in India’s online news ecosystem with an impressive performance on YouTube during January.

As per data released by Playboard, NDTV 24×7 emerged as the most-watched English news channel on YouTube in January 2026, garnering 129.21 million views to claim the top spot. In the Hindi news segment, NDTV India recorded a massive 1,914.30 million views during the month, comfortably placing it ahead of several established competitors such as Times Now Navbharat, India TV, TV9 Bharatvarsh, ABP News, and Republic Bharat. The figures underline NDTV’s growing influence across both English and Hindi digital audiences.

In an official press release issued by NDTV, Rahul Kanwal, CEO and Editor-in-Chief, described the performance as a reflection of sustained digital focus and teamwork. He said the January YouTube numbers highlight the consistent efforts of NDTV’s digital teams across platforms, adding that digital has clearly become a primary destination for news consumption. Kanwal emphasised that the network remains committed to delivering credible journalism and meaningful conversations that audiences can trust on platforms like YouTube.

The strong showing in January mirrors NDTV’s broader digital strategy, which places equal emphasis on breaking news, explainers, long-form stories, and live coverage. By creating formats specifically designed for digital-first audiences, the network has been able to scale its reach while staying aligned with its core editorial values of clarity, balance, and credibility.

Looking ahead, NDTV plans to introduce new digital conversations and formats over the coming months as it continues to deepen engagement across platforms. With changing news consumption habits in India, the network aims to strengthen its digital footprint while remaining rooted in the trust that defines its journalism. This steady and focused approach, NDTV says, will continue to guide its digital journey in a rapidly evolving media landscape.
